What the Session Feels Like

It usually starts with a short conversation. Nothing too detailed just enough to understand what’s bothering you.

Then the treatment begins slowly.

The first few minutes are lighter. Muscles need time to warm up. After that, pressure increases where it’s needed most.

Some areas release quickly. Others take more time.

You might feel:

  • Deep, steady pressure in tight spots
  • A bit of resistance at first, then a gradual release
  • Moments that feel slightly intense, but manageable

It’s not meant to be painful. But it’s also not purely relaxing the entire time.

It sits somewhere in between and that’s usually where the real change happens.

How Often Should You Come In?

There isn’t a fixed schedule.

Some people come once a month and feel fine. Others need more frequent sessions at the beginning every couple of weeks especially if there’s ongoing tension.

It depends on your body, your routine, and how things respond.

What tends to work best is consistency. Not necessarily more sessions just regular ones.

What You Might Notice Afterward

After an RMT session, the changes aren’t always dramatic.

You might feel:

  • Looser in your movement
  • Slightly sore in certain areas
  • More relaxed overall

That soreness, if it happens, usually fades within a day.

And then there’s the quieter effect. You move through your day without noticing the same level of tension.

It’s subtle but it builds.
